One of the secrets to the deliciousness of this smoothie is...
The coffee ice cubes. <---- you heard me right!
They're so good and sooooooo easy. Just get a simple ice cube tray and freeze any leftover coffee... or make a fresh batch. They're worth it! I blend them right into the smoothie. 3 Ingredient Eggnog Smoothies
Description
3 Ingredient Eggnog Smoothies -- so easy and festive! // via Nosh and Nourish
Ingredients
1 cup Almond Nog* (or sub regular eggnog)
1 scoop of Vanilla Toffee Vegan Protein Powder** (or sub vanilla)
1 1⁄2 cup coffee ice cubes (or use some coffee ones and some plain water ones)
